- Second oldest known Bible
- 3,036 differences between Sinaiticus and Vaticanus Codex (oldest known
Bible)
- Dates to within two-four decades of Constantine's conversion to
Christianity (330-350)
- Includes two books not in modern Bible: Epistle of Barnabas, and portions
of The Shepherd of Hermas
